Semaglutide — Mechanism & Evidence

Semaglutide is a synthetic analog of human glucagon-like peptide-1 (GLP-1) with 94% sequence homology, engineered for prolonged half-life via fatty acid acylation. It activates the GLP-1 receptor, enhancing glucose-dependent insulin secretion, suppressing glucagon release, and delaying gastric emptying. Its molecular weight is approximately 4113.6 g/mol (C187H291N45O59). Developed by Novo Nordisk, it received initial FDA approval on December 5, 2017, for type 2 diabetes (Ozempic), followed by indications for weight management (Wegovy) and non-cirrhotic MASH. The evidence base is robust, encompassing the STEP and SUSTAIN trial programs with thousands of participants, demonstrating significant weight loss, improved glycemic control, and reduced cardiovascular events. No generic version exists, and the FDA has issued warnings about counterfeit products. Key research claims include substantial weight reduction, enhanced blood sugar regulation, and decreased cardiovascular risk.

Pancragen — Mechanism & Evidence

Pancragen (Lys-Glu-Asp-Trp, KEDW) is a synthetic tetrapeptide with a molecular weight of approximately 562.6 g/mol, belonging to the Khavinson bioregulatory peptide family. It is proposed to act as a pancreas-specific bioregulator, potentially restoring beta-cell function, improving insulin secretion, and normalizing glucose metabolism, particularly in the context of aging or metabolic dysfunction. The published evidence is primarily found in Russian biogerontology literature, with studies often conducted in preclinical models and small human cohorts. While the mechanism is not fully elucidated at the molecular level, research suggests it may modulate gene expression related to pancreatic regeneration. Key claims include improved glucose metabolism and restoration of beta-cell function, though the evidence base is less extensive than for Semaglutide.

Shared Research Applications

Both Semaglutide and Pancragen are investigated for metabolic health, specifically glucose regulation and insulin sensitivity. However, their research scopes diverge significantly. Semaglutide is also extensively studied for weight management and cardiovascular outcomes, reflecting its broader clinical applications. In contrast, Pancragen is primarily researched in the context of anti-aging and longevity, with a focus on pancreatic function and age-related metabolic decline. This distinction underscores that while both peptides target metabolic pathways, Semaglutide is suited for studies on obesity and cardiovascular risk, whereas Pancragen may be more relevant for investigations into pancreatic aging and regenerative biology.

Safety Considerations

Semaglutide's safety profile is well-characterized from clinical trials. Common adverse effects (occurring in 5% or more of participants) include nausea, vomiting, diarrhea, abdominal pain, and constipation, which are typically dose-dependent and transient. Additional effects include upset stomach, heartburn, burping, gas, bloating, loss of appetite, headache, dizziness, and tiredness. Serious but rare events include pancreatitis, gallbladder disease, and severe allergic reactions (e.g., hives, swelling, difficulty breathing). For Pancragen, the published literature reports it as well-tolerated with no serious adverse events documented. However, researchers should monitor blood glucose levels when Pancragen is used alongside antidiabetic medications, as interactions have not been thoroughly studied. The limited safety data for Pancragen necessitates cautious interpretation.
